Hi Vadim,
Did you follow the upgrade instructions (especially the systemvm upgrading):
http://cloudstack-release-notes.readthedocs.org/en/4.4.1/upgrade/upgrade-4.4.html
If consoles are not coming up, please upgrade systemvms to 4.4.1 ones and
delete existing console proxy VM(s) and retry.
